The Double Bay Market Right Now

Double Bay’s market corrected recently. The median house price is $7.28 million with annual growth of -2.93% (though recent quarters show 16.67% quarterly growth, suggesting stabilisation). Sales are limited: 24 houses in the past 12 months at 56 days on market. That’s not a sign of weakness—it’s the nature of ultra-premium markets. Everything sells, but nothing moves fast because every sale is considered.

Units are more active: 103 unit sales, with median prices at $2.05 million and 2.50% annual growth. For renters or investors wanting exposure to Double Bay, units offer more accessibility.

The reality: Double Bay isn’t for price-chasing. It’s for buyers who want the address, the address, the address. Finance strategy here is about preserving wealth, not building it aggressively.

SMSF Property Loans

Borrowing through a self-managed superannuation fund to acquire property is a specialist area. The lending criteria, loan structures, and compliance requirements are significantly more complex than standard residential or commercial finance. We work with lenders experienced in SMSF property lending and help you navigate the documentation, valuation requirements, and trustee obligations properly. For high-net-worth individuals, SMSF property loans can be tax-efficient and offer asset protection benefits that standard mortgages don’t provide.

Private Lending

For situations where mainstream lenders can’t move fast enough or where standard credit criteria isn’t the right fit, private lending offers a different path. Bridging finance covers timing gaps when you’re selling one property and buying another. Second mortgages let you access equity in an existing property without refinancing your primary loan. Caveat loans are short-term, asset-backed facilities for time-sensitive situations. These are specialist products—more expensive than standard mortgages, structured around the asset rather than the borrower profile—so they’re not right for every situation. We assess your full picture before recommending private lending, and only suggest it when the benefits clearly outweigh the costs.
